The Cadillac DTS fog light is a vital component that enhances visibility during adverse weather conditions such as fog, rain, or snow. Positioned low on the vehicle's front end, the fog lamp emits a wide, short-range beam that cuts through fog and illuminates the road directly ahead, improving safety and reducing the risk of accidents.
Fog lights play a crucial role in ensuring driver safety by providing better illumination in poor visibility conditions. They are specifically designed to reduce glare and prevent light from reflecting back into the driver's eyes, which can happen with standard headlights in foggy environments.
Owners of the Cadillac DTS may encounter common issues with fog lights, including bulb burnout, lens damage, or moisture buildup inside the housing. These problems can diminish light output and effectiveness, making it important to address them promptly to maintain optimal visibility.
Regular maintenance of fog lights can extend their lifespan and ensure they function properly. Tips include cleaning the fog light lenses to remove dirt and debris, checking for cracks or chips in the lens, and ensuring the housing seals are intact to prevent moisture intrusion. Replacing worn-out bulbs promptly also helps maintain optimal light output.
Installing a new fog light on a Cadillac DTS involves removing the old unit and replacing it with a new one. It's important to disconnect the vehicle's battery before starting to prevent electrical issues. Follow the manufacturer's instructions carefully, and consider consulting a professional mechanic if unsure about the installation process to ensure the fog lamp is properly aligned and secured.
Q: How do I know if my fog light needs replacement?
A: Signs that your fog light may need replacing include reduced brightness, a cracked or damaged lens, moisture inside the light housing, or the fog light not turning on even after replacing the bulb.
Q: Can I replace the fog light bulb myself?
A: Yes, if you have basic automotive knowledge and the proper tools, you can replace the fog light bulb yourself. Refer to the vehicle's owner's manual for specific instructions and safety precautions.
Q: Are there upgrades available for the Cadillac DTS fog lights?
A: Upgrades such as LED fog lights are available and can provide brighter illumination and longer lifespan compared to standard bulbs. Ensure that any upgrades are compatible with your vehicle and comply with local regulations.
Q: What's the difference between fog lights and regular headlights?
A: Fog lights are designed to provide a wide, low beam that cuts under the fog to illuminate the road directly ahead, whereas regular headlights emit a focused beam that can reflect off fog and reduce visibility. Fog lamps are intended for use in poor weather conditions where standard headlights may be less effective.
